zl程序教程

MySQL 元数据

  • Mysql | 数据库锁表的原因和解决方法「建议收藏」

    Mysql | 数据库锁表的原因和解决方法「建议收藏」

    大家好,又见面了,我是你们的朋友全栈君。锁表的原因: 当多个连接(数据库连接)同时对一个表的数据进行更新操作,那么速度将会越来越慢,持续一段时间后将出现数据表被锁的现象,从而影响到其它的查询及更新。   例如: 存储过程循环30次更新操作(cycore_file_id 为唯一标识)/*30次更新操作*/ BEGIN DECLARE v1 INT DEFAULT 30; WHILE v

    日期 2023-06-12 10:48:40     
  • 第五章· MySQL数据类型

    第五章· MySQL数据类型

    一.数据类型介绍二.列属性介绍曾志高翔, 江湖人称曾老大。多年互联网运维工作经验,曾负责过大规模集群架构自动化运维管理工作。擅长Web集群架构与自动化运维,曾负责国内某大型金融公司运维工作。 个人博客:"DBA老司机带你删库跑路"一.数据类型介绍1.四种主要类别1)数值类型 2)字符类型 3)时间类型 4)二进制类型2.数据类型的 ABC 要素1)Appropriat

    日期 2023-06-12 10:48:40     
  • mysqldump指定数据表导出

    mysqldump指定数据表导出

    mysqldump指定数据表导出 作者:matrix 被围观: 1,835 次 发布时间:2021-03-31 分类:mysql | 一条评论 » 这是一个创建于 518 天前的主题,其中的信息可能已经有所发展或是发生改变。 平时习惯使用mysql客户端工具直接导出表数据,这突然需要导出指定前缀的表反而变得麻烦,因为表非常多但又不想全部选择。e.g. 导出dict_开头的数据表查询符合条件

    日期 2023-06-12 10:48:40     
  • MySQL报错1062_mysql数据库报错

    MySQL报错1062_mysql数据库报错

    mysql在主从复制过程中,由于各种的原因,从服务器可能会遇到执行BINLOG中的SQL出错的情况,在默认情况下,服务器会停止复制进程,不再进行同步,等到用户自行来处理。slave-skip-errors的作用就是用来定义复制过程中从服务器可以自动跳过的错误号,当复制过程中遇到定义的错误号,就可以自动跳过,直接执行后面的SQL语句mysql主从库同步错误:1062 Error ‘Duplicate

    日期 2023-06-12 10:48:40     
  • mysql数据库面试题目及答案_java面试数据库常见问题

    mysql数据库面试题目及答案_java面试数据库常见问题

    大家好,又见面了,我是你们的朋友全栈君。 其他面试题类型汇总: Java校招极大几率出的面试题(含答案)—-汇总 几率大的网络安全面试题(含答案) 几率大的多线程面试题(含答案) 几率大的源码底层原理,杂食面试题(含答案) 几率大的Redis面试题(含答案) 几率大的linux命令面试题(含答案) 几率大的杂乱+操作系统面试题(含答案) 几率大的SSM框架面试题(含答案)

    日期 2023-06-12 10:48:40     
  • h2数据库连接mysql_H2数据库简单使用操作「建议收藏」

    h2数据库连接mysql_H2数据库简单使用操作「建议收藏」

    h2database官网下载客户端控制台h2database Maven配置com.h2databaseh21.4.1991 控制台新建数据库与连接数据库1.1建库windows系统下点击h2/bin/h2.bat启动控制台应用程序鼠标右键点击桌面右下角图标 Create a new database…例如在k盘h2目录下新建helloForm数据库,则填写路径为k:/h2/helloForm1.

    日期 2023-06-12 10:48:40     
  • MySQL数据类型

    MySQL数据类型

    MySQL之数据类型MySQL常见的数据类型有数值、日期和时间、字符串数值整数类型(精确值)Integer Types (Exact Value) - INTEGER, INT, SMALLINT, TINYINT, MEDIUMINT, BIGINTint tinyint bigint不动点类型(精确值)-十进制,数字Fixed-Point Types (Exact Value) - DECIM

    日期 2023-06-12 10:48:40     
  • MySQL数据备份

    MySQL数据备份

    MySQL备份概述问题:备份和冗余有什么区别?备份:能够防止由于机械故障以及人为操作带来的数据丢失,例如将数据库文件保存在了其它地方。冗余:数据有多份冗余,但不等于备份,只能防止机械故障带来的数据丢失,例如主备模式、数据库集群。备份是什么? databases     Binlog  my.cnf       /data/xxx(数据目录)备份数据库,还有日志文件,还有配置文件,尽可能将数据目录里

    日期 2023-06-12 10:48:40     
  • mysql数据库备份和还原的命令_Mysql数据库备份和还原常用的命令

    mysql数据库备份和还原的命令_Mysql数据库备份和还原常用的命令

    大家好,又见面了,我是你们的朋友全栈君。Mysql数据库备份和还原常用的命令是进行Mysql数据库备份和还原的关键,没有命令,什么都无从做起,更谈不上什么备份还原,只有给系统这个命令,让它去执行,才能完成Mysql数据库备份和还原的操作,下面就是操作的常用命令。一、备份命令1、备份MySQL数据库的命令mysqldump -hhostname -uusername -ppassword datab

    日期 2023-06-12 10:48:40     
  • [1156]MySQL数据库可用性监控脚本

    [1156]MySQL数据库可用性监控脚本

    文章目录MySQL数据库可用性监控脚本可用行性能监控MySQL数据库可用性监控脚本方法一:通过测试账号ping命令返回的信息判断数据库可以通过网络连接 [root@host-39-108-217-12 scripts]# cat mysql-available-status.sh #!/bin/bash MYSQL_PING=`/usr/bin/mysqladmin -uroot -p123

    日期 2023-06-12 10:48:40     
  • MySql数据库基本select查询语句练习题,初学者易懂。

    MySql数据库基本select查询语句练习题,初学者易懂。

    大家好,又见面了,我是你们的朋友全栈君。在数据库建立四个表:分别为student(sid,sname,sage,ssex)teacher(tid,tname)course(cid,cname,tid)sc(sid,cid,score)— 1、查询“001”课程比”002″课程成绩高的所有学生的学号。select a.sid FROM (select * from sc where cid=”00

    日期 2023-06-12 10:48:40     
  • mysql数据库安装(详细)

    mysql数据库安装(详细)

    大家好,又见面了,我是你们的朋友全栈君。 安装MySQLMySQL是目前最为流行的开放源码的数据库,是完全网络化的跨平台的关系型数据库系统,它是由瑞典MySQLAB公司开发,目前属于Oracle公司。任何人都能从Internet下载MySQL软件,而无需支付任费用,并且“开放源码”意味着任何人都可以使用和修改该软件。一、下载MySQL第一步:下载mysql,地址:https://dev.mys

    日期 2023-06-12 10:48:40     
  • mysql longtext 查询_mysql中longtext存在大量数据时,会导致查询很慢?

    mysql longtext 查询_mysql中longtext存在大量数据时,会导致查询很慢?

    大家好,又见面了,我是你们的朋友全栈君。一个表,1.5w条数据,字段: id,name,content,last_update_timeid,自定义主键name,varchar类型content是longtext类型,last_update_time为datetime类型,不为空content当中是文本和代码等,平均长度在20k+。case1:select id, name from t orde

    日期 2023-06-12 10:48:40     
  • mysql executereader_C# 操作MySQL数据库, ExecuteReader()方法参数化执行T-SQL语句, 游标读取数据…

    mysql executereader_C# 操作MySQL数据库, ExecuteReader()方法参数化执行T-SQL语句, 游标读取数据…

    大家好,又见面了,我是你们的朋友全栈君。C# 操作My SQL数据库需要引用”MySql.Data”, 可通过两种方式获取。1、从NuGet下载”Install-Package MySql.Data -Version 6.8.7″推荐使用方式一,从NuGet上直接获取所需dll,方便快捷。C# 操作MySQL数据库, ExecuteReader()方法参数化执行T-SQL语句, 游标读取数据–Ex

    日期 2023-06-12 10:48:40     
  • Mysql插入数据报错java.sql.SQLException: Incorrect string value: ‘xF0x9Fx98x8DxE8xBE…'[通俗易懂]

    Mysql插入数据报错java.sql.SQLException: Incorrect string value: ‘xF0x9Fx98x8DxE8xBE…'[通俗易懂]

    大家好,又见面了,我是你们的朋友全栈君。前几日在项目中遇到数据库插入数据报错java.sql.SQLException: Incorrect string value: ‘\xF0\x9F\x98\x8D\xE8\xBE…’ for column ‘title’ at row 1 一直以为是中文字符编码不对,然后找了各种编码的东西。后来无意中发现了一篇文章:http://blog.csdn.ne

    日期 2023-06-12 10:48:40     
  • 从零到上亿用户,我是如何一步步优化MySQL数据库的?(建议收藏)[通俗易懂]

    从零到上亿用户,我是如何一步步优化MySQL数据库的?(建议收藏)[通俗易懂]

    大家好,又见面了,我是你们的朋友全栈君。 大家好,我是冰河~~很多小伙伴留言说让我写一些工作过程中的真实案例,写些啥呢?想来想去,写一篇我在以前公司从零开始到用户超千万的数据库架构升级演变的过程吧。本文记录了我之前初到一家创业公司,从零开始到用户超千万,系统压力暴增的情况下是如何一步步优化MySQL数据库的,以及数据库架构升级的演变过程。升级的过程极具技术挑战性,也从中收获不少。希望能够为小伙

    日期 2023-06-12 10:48:40     
  • mysql数据库报错1146_关于MySQL报错:[ERR] 1146

    mysql数据库报错1146_关于MySQL报错:[ERR] 1146

    大家好,又见面了,我是你们的朋友全栈君。最近因为电脑重装了系统,导致自己原本的数据库呗覆盖,需要重新重新安装数据库,但是由于我之前数据库版本是mysql 5.0.22,版本太低,所以小编决定安装mysql 5.7.23版本的,一开始没什么问题,根据之前的安装路径安装成功后,接着配置了mysql的环境变量mysql_path,,然后在数据库编辑工具Navicat for MySQL打开后,进行了一个

    日期 2023-06-12 10:48:40     
  • 查询mysql的隔离级别_怎么查看数据库隔离级别

    查询mysql的隔离级别_怎么查看数据库隔离级别

    大家好,又见面了,我是你们的朋友全栈君。CPUQuota=value该参数表示服务可以获取的最大 CPU 时间,value 为百分数形式,高于 100% 表示可使用 1 核以上的 CPU。与 cgroup cpu 控制器 cpu.cfs_quota_us 配置项对应。MemoryLimit=value该参数表示服务可以使用的最大内存量,value 可以使用 K, M, G, T 等后缀表示值的大小

    日期 2023-06-12 10:48:40     
  • windows MySQL数据库备份bat脚本[通俗易懂]

    windows MySQL数据库备份bat脚本[通俗易懂]

    大家好,又见面了,我是你们的朋友全栈君。 在windows服务器上,想要定时备份数据库数据,可采用windows的任务计划程序+数据库备份脚本组合。 其中,MySQL数据库备份,起到关键作用是mysqldump。有关于mysqldump命令的用法,可以找MySQL的官方文档了解。 以下主要描述脚本:echo 设置MySql数据库的连接信息 set host=127.0.0.1 set us

    日期 2023-06-12 10:48:40     
  • 怎么监控mysql数据变化_mysql数据库数据变化实时监控

    怎么监控mysql数据变化_mysql数据库数据变化实时监控

    大家好,又见面了,我是你们的朋友全栈君。对于二次开发来说,很大一部分就找找文件和找数据库的变化情况对于数据库变化。还没有发现比较好用的监控数据库变化监控软件。今天,我就给大家介绍一个如何使用mysql自带的功能监控数据库变化1、打开数据库配置文件my.ini (一般在数据库安装目录)(D:\MYSQL)2、在数据库的最后一行添加 log=log.txt 代码3、重启mysql数据库4、去数据库数据

    日期 2023-06-12 10:48:40     
  • mysql批量清空表数据脚本「建议收藏」

    mysql批量清空表数据脚本「建议收藏」

    大家好,又见面了,我是你们的朋友全栈君。今天手中拿到个之前的db,我要做测试,但是里面表结构比较多,确认数据已经没有用了,但是表结构不知道 有没有用;所以想着把里面的数据给清空了;奈何数据太多,schema都有2k多了,这一个个敲命令得搞死写了个脚本做记录,以后用到就拿过来复用;#!/bin/bash mysql --login-path=localhost -e "use info

    日期 2023-06-12 10:48:40     
  • MySQL数据类型DECIMAL用法

    MySQL数据类型DECIMAL用法

    大家好,又见面了,我是你们的朋友全栈君。MySQL DECIMAL数据类型用于在数据库中存储精确的数值。我们经常将DECIMAL数据类型用于保留准确精确度的列,例如会计系统中的货币数据。要定义数据类型为DECIMAL的列,请使用以下语法:column_name DECIMAL(P,D);复制在上面的语法中:P是表示有效数字数的精度。 P范围为1〜65。D是表示小数点后的位数。 D的范围是0~30

    日期 2023-06-12 10:48:40     
  • 【MySQL 数据库】数据库的基础知识「建议收藏」

    【MySQL 数据库】数据库的基础知识「建议收藏」

    大家好,又见面了,我是你们的朋友全栈君。 文章目录1. 认识数据库 1.1 数据库和数据结构的关系1.2 为什么需要数据库1.3 数据库的存储2. SQL 2.1 介绍2.2 分类3. 数据库的类别 3.1 关系型数据库3.2 非关系型数据库3.3 区别4. MySQL 的程序结构 4.1 客户端和服务器4.2 MySQL 的客户端-服务器结构4.3 MySQL 服务器1. 认识数据库1.1

    日期 2023-06-12 10:48:40     
  • javaweb登录注册功能实现 javaweb 登陆注册 入门 mysql数据库交互 web前后台交互 用户管理增删改查 实现登录 注册 登陆 JavaWeb 简单登陆注册「建议收藏」

    javaweb登录注册功能实现 javaweb 登陆注册 入门 mysql数据库交互 web前后台交互 用户管理增删改查 实现登录 注册 登陆 JavaWeb 简单登陆注册「建议收藏」

    大家好,又见面了,我是你们的朋友全栈君。用户登录注册流程图老版:新版:登陆界面 注册界面登陆成功界面LoginServletimport java.io.IOException; import javax.servlet.ServletException; import javax.servlet.annotation.WebServlet; import javax.servlet.http.H

    日期 2023-06-12 10:48:40     
  • transactionscope mysql,如何将TransactionScope与MySql和多个数据库服务器一起使用[通俗易懂]

    transactionscope mysql,如何将TransactionScope与MySql和多个数据库服务器一起使用[通俗易懂]

    大家好,又见面了,我是你们的朋友全栈君。TransactionOptions TransOpt = new TransactionOptions();TransOpt.IsolationLevel = System.Transactions.IsolationLevel.ReadCommitted;TransOpt.Timeout = new TimeSpan(0, 2, 0);using (Tr

    日期 2023-06-12 10:48:40     
  • MySQL数据库建立数据库和表(命令行方式)

    MySQL数据库建立数据库和表(命令行方式)

    大家好,又见面了,我是你们的朋友全栈君。最近在学数据库系统概论,以前建表都是直接用workbeach,但是作为一个计算机专业的学生,我觉得能敲的时候就少点,所以分享一个自己用命令创建数据库和表的过程,希望对一些人有点用!安装好数据库后,我们可以看到这些东西可以这么简单的认识,划红线的是通过命令行来操作数据库,划绿线的是操作数据库的图形化界面,这里我分享的是通过命令行来操作,以《数据库系统概论》第五

    日期 2023-06-12 10:48:40     
  • mysql 百万数据测试迁移对比

    mysql 百万数据测试迁移对比

    第一种迁移方案mysqldump迁移 mysqldump导出数据库成一个sql文件(快)scp命令复制到另一台服务器(快)source命令导入数据,cpu跑满(比较耗时)脚本迁移 命令行操作数据库进行数据的导出和导入(比较耗时)第二种迁移方案redis搭建一个“生产+消费”的迁移方案 在源数据服务器上跑一个多线程脚本,并行读取数据库里面的数据,并把数据写入到redis队列目标服务器作为一个消费者,

    日期 2023-06-12 10:48:40     
  • springboot连接mysql数据库配置文件「建议收藏」

    springboot连接mysql数据库配置文件「建议收藏」

    大家好,又见面了,我是你们的朋友全栈君。 springboot连接mysql数据库配置文件:spring: datasource: username: root password: root url: jdbc:mysql://localhost:3306/user_db?useUnicode=true&characterEncoding=utf-8&

    日期 2023-06-12 10:48:40     
  • springboot连接mysql数据库测试

    springboot连接mysql数据库测试

    大家好,又见面了,我是你们的朋友全栈君。springboot连接mysql数据库pom文件依赖<dependency> <groupId>mysql</groupId> <artifactId>mysql-connector-java</artifactId> </de

    日期 2023-06-12 10:48:40     
  • SpringBoot +JDBC连接Mysql数据库

    SpringBoot +JDBC连接Mysql数据库

    大家好,又见面了,我是你们的朋友全栈君。SpringBoot 使用JDBC连接Mysql数据库    Spring连接Mysql的方式有很多,例如JDBC,Spring JPA,Hibeirnate,Mybatis等,本文主要介绍使用最简单、最底层的JDBC方式来连接Mysql数据库,JDBC连接数据库,主要是注入JdbcTemplate,使用JdbcTemplate来操作数据库。一、在mysql

    日期 2023-06-12 10:48:40     
  • springboot|springboot连接mysql数据库

    springboot|springboot连接mysql数据库

    大家好,又见面了,我是你们的朋友全栈君。 javaDEMO 本网站记录了最全的各种JavaDEMO ,保证下载,复制就是可用的,包括基础的, 集合的, spring的, Mybatis的等等各种,助力你从菜鸟到大牛,记得收藏哦~~ https://www.javastudy.cloud 配置springboot连接mysql数据库 主要分以下几步: 添加gradle/maven依赖 配

    日期 2023-06-12 10:48:40